How Long Does Juvelook Last? Results Timeline & Maintenance

How Long Does Juvelook Last? Results Timeline, Product Differences and Maintenance

Written by FillersFairy Editorial · Reviewed by FillersFairy Clinical Team · Last updated: June 21, 2026

Quick Answer

Juvelook typically lasts 6–12 months after completing a three-session course at one-month intervals. VAIM’s longer-acting formulation, Lenisna, is reported to last 18–24 months. Results peak around Month 3–6 when the PDLLA-stimulated collagen matrix has had time to mature. Duration varies with patient age, skin condition, treatment area and lifestyle factors.

Duration by Product

VAIM offers two formulations with different duration profiles:

Product Duration Best For
Juvelook (50 mg/vial) 6–12 months Fine lines, pores, skin texture, periorbital area
Lenisna 18–24 months Full-face rejuvenation, volumising, maximum longevity

Both based on a standard three-session course at one-month intervals. Depending on the market, the higher-concentration formulation may be marketed as “Juvelook Volume” or “Lenisna.” Product packaging in some markets shows 200 mg/vial for the higher-dose version.

The general principle: Higher PDLLA concentration stimulates more collagen over a longer period. The standard Juvelook (50 mg/vial) uses smaller microparticles at lower concentration for superficial treatment. The longer-acting formulation uses more PDLLA for deeper, more sustained collagen stimulation.

The Duration Timeline

Juvelook’s effects build, peak and gradually fade rather than switching on and off. The typical timeframes below are based on the manufacturer’s reported treatment protocol and general PDLLA collagen biology:

Phase Typical Timing What Practitioners Can Expect
Building Month 0–3 Three sessions administered monthly. Each adds PDLLA microparticles that stimulate collagen. HA provides interim hydration. Results are cumulative.
Peak Month 3–6 New collagen matrix is maturing. Skin elasticity, texture and firmness at their strongest. Best window for before-and-after photography and outcome assessment.
Plateau Month 6–9 Much of the injected PDLLA may have undergone biodegradation by this stage. The collagen it stimulated remains but undergoes normal biological turnover. Results are still present but beginning to soften.
Gradual fade Month 9–12+ Natural collagen turnover gradually reduces the treatment effect. Practitioners may consider reassessment and maintenance at this stage.

What Affects How Long Juvelook Lasts

Practitioner-controlled factors

Injection depth. Placement depth influences treatment response. PDLLA microparticles need to interact with fibroblasts in the dermis to trigger collagen production. Product selection and technique should follow the manufacturer’s instructions and practitioner training.

Product selection. Matching the right product to the right indication directly impacts outcomes. The standard Juvelook for superficial skin quality concerns; the higher-concentration formulation for deeper structural improvement.

Session completion. Patients who complete all three sessions typically see more sustained results than those who stop after one or two, because cumulative PDLLA from multiple sessions builds a denser collagen response.

Patient-related factors

Age and baseline collagen. Younger patients with more active fibroblasts may see results at the longer end of the duration range. Older patients may benefit most from consistent maintenance.

Sun exposure. UV radiation degrades collagen. Consistent daily sunscreen use is likely the most impactful lifestyle factor for preserving treatment results.

Smoking. Smoking may impair collagen synthesis and could reduce the quality or persistence of collagen-stimulating treatment results.

Duration Compared to Alternatives

Product Mechanism Reported Duration Sessions
Juvelook PDLLA + HA hybrid 6–12 months 3 (monthly)
Sculptra PLLA Up to 25 months (FDA label) 3–4 (6-week intervals)
Profhilo Stabilised HA ~6 months 2 (4-week intervals)
HA Skin Boosters (Hyaron) Non-crosslinked HA 3–6 months 3–4 (2-4 week intervals)
Lenisna Premium PDLLA + HA 18–24 months 3 (monthly)

Durations based on manufacturer data and product labels.

For Clinics: Maintenance Planning and Inventory Considerations

Maintenance timing. Many practitioners reassess patients around Month 6–9 for a maintenance session. Patients who maintain a regular schedule typically report progressively better baseline skin quality over time.

Proactive communication. Clinics that reach out at the 5–6 month mark for a reassessment appointment see higher treatment continuation rates. This is consistent across all collagen-stimulating treatments.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does Juvelook last?

The manufacturer reports 6–12 months for Juvelook after completing a three-session course at one-month intervals. Lenisna, VAIM’s longer-acting formulation, is reported to last 18–24 months. Individual results depend on age, skin condition, treatment area, injection technique and lifestyle factors.

Is Juvelook longer lasting than Profhilo?

Based on manufacturer-reported durations, Juvelook (6–12 months) outlasts Profhilo (~6 months). However, direct head-to-head clinical comparisons between the two products are limited, and the treatments target somewhat different endpoints (Juvelook: PDLLA collagen stimulation + HA hydration; Profhilo: HA bio-remodelling).

How often do I need Juvelook maintenance?

Many practitioners recommend a maintenance session every 6–9 months after the initial three-session course. Regular maintenance helps sustain skin quality improvements and can extend the overall treatment benefit.

Does Juvelook Volume last longer than regular Juvelook?

Depending on the market, VAIM’s higher-concentration PDLLA formulation may be marketed as “Juvelook Volume” or “Lenisna.” The manufacturer reports 18–24 months for this formulation versus 6–12 months for standard Juvelook. Clinics should verify the exact product name and specifications on their local packaging.

Why did my Juvelook results fade faster than expected?

Possible factors include incomplete treatment course (fewer than three sessions), injection depth or technique variables, sun exposure, smoking, or individual patient metabolism. Discuss with your treating practitioner about adjustments for your next course.
